British retailer Tesco accused of selling stripper pole as toy

Categories: Development, Media, Toys & Games

With all the ten-year olds modelling super-skimpy bikinis these days, and, well, the clothes they're selling to preteen girls just about everywhere, I guess it shouldn't be so surprising that a large British retailer has started selling a "stripper pole kit" in the toy section of its website. Tesco is Britain's largest chain retailer, and its website has been advertising the kit unbder the "toy" category with the underlying text, "Unleash the sex kitten inside...simply extend the Peekaboo pole inside the tube, slip on the sexy tunes and away you go! Soon you'll be flaunting it to the world and earning a fortune in Peekaboo Dance Dollars."

The kit, which costs about 50 British pounds, includes an extendable stripper pole, a "sexy dance garter," and a DVD that teaches the viewer how to remove their knickers. Sexily.

Tesco today agreed to remove the product from the Toy section of its site, but said it will remain for sale under the category of "fitness accessory."
